Structural Qualifications, and Technical References.

The units are designed in accordance with the recommendations of:-
BS 5268 structural use of timber.
BS 6399 : 1996 Part 1 Code of Practice for dead and imposed loads.
BS 6399 : 1997 Part 2 Code of Practice for Wind Loads.
BS 6399 : 1988 Part 3 Code of Practice for imposed roof loads

The minimum imposed loads are as follows.

Roof 0.75 kN/m2 Floor 3.0 kN/m2

Stability

The buildings are designed to withstand any lateral or overturning movements due to the actions of a basic wind speed of 54 m/s in accordance with BS 6399 : 1997 Part 2.

Thermal Insulation

Fast-Track 3000 units comply with the following thermal values.

Walls                                                  0.30 W/m²K
Floor                                                   0.22 W/m²K
Roof                                                   0.20 W/m²K

Sound Insulation

External walls and internal partition walls provide a minimum sound insulation value of 37d/B in accordance with BS 8233 : 1987,
Code of Practice for sound insulation and noise reductions for buildings.
Higher levels can be achieved by using double layer plasterboard and acoustic insulation subject to client requirements.

Structure

Specification for standard elemental structure to determine rate m2 of variable floor area and plan configuration.

Walls

Plastisol Plastic Coated Steel.

Clad externally with 0.5 mm thick galvanized Plastisol plastic coated steel (galvanizing to BS EN 10143 : 1993) (200 microns thick min) which is to be bonded to 9 WBP plywood at a pressure of 14.5 PSI. The steel faced plywood panels are fixed to 120mm x 38mm timber framework incorporating insulation to comply with u-values quoted.
Walls lined internally with 12.7mm Vapourshield, vinyl faced plasterboard. Joints between adjacent sheets are fitted with 2 part  PVC extruded jointing section.
GRP laminate boarding to all wet areas.

Option – Various external finishes available, subject to Local Planning Authority.

Roofs

Steel lattice beams with steel flitch plates are crossed with treated 120mm x 38mm timber joists. Over decked with 11mm OSB particle board, and sealed with a monolithic Hypalon weatherproof membrane, laid in accordance to manufactures instructions.
Standard dual shallow pitch roof ensures correct drainage.
Rain water is disposed of by means of full length plastic guttering to both pitch sides of buildings.
Down pipes are situated to suit.

Option - Pitch tiled roof

Ceiling

Internally the ceiling is lined with 12.7 mm Vapourshield backed vinyl faced plasterboard. Joints between adjacent sheets are fitted with 2- part  PVC extruded jointing section.
Insulation is incorporated into the structure to meet u-values quoted.

Option - Armstrong grid system suspended ceiling complete with recessed lighting available

Floors

Lattice steel floor structure, treated with anti oxidizing paint finish, supporting treated 120mm x 38mm timber floor joists and other timber members to provide a strong rigid component and be capable of carrying minimum imposed floor loading of 3KnM2. Floor decking is of tongue and grooved 18 mm V313 moisture resistant particle board.

Compliance with heat loss figures quoted is achieved using Ecobrite  thermo foil.

Increased imposed floor loadings available at additional cost

Floor Covering

Consisting as standard of Marley PU 2 mm heavy duty sheet vinyl floor covering, with the maximum Agrement rating of G5ws. Marley PU is manufactured to meet all the performance requirements of the following standards;
BS 3261 : Part1 :1973:Type A
BS 476 : Part 7 :1987
Marley PU is available in a range of colors, unless otherwise stated ref 9200 Seal grey is fitted as standard. All joints are factory welded.

Textile Floor Coverings

A heavy duty low loop pile for laying on a plywood base and includes for all necessary adhesives and grippers.
Common examples used include the Burmatex and Heckmondwyke Range of contract carpets.

External Doors.

Solid core external flush type 926mm x 2040mm Door to be decorated as per specification All external doors are fitted with a door closer along with 1 1/2 pairs 100 mm steel butt hinges. Door furniture as standard consists of a 3 lever lock and aluminium lever lock handles. Floor mounted door stops are provided to all internal opening doors. All external doors are fitted with a aluminium low cill threshold, with draught exclusion facility. Pre finished aluminium drips are fitted above each external door. Vision panels are provided at high & low level, compliant with DDA regulations.
Emergency exit doors are fitted with a panic bar & inclusive of signage.

Windows

Standard size of window 1100mm high x 910mm wide with 50% top opening sash.
Constructed from PVCu framing, side fixed into timber panel. Top sash pre glazed. All glazing to current Building regulations including K glass. Windows are fitted with 4000 sq mm of trickle ventilation.
Locking system to be twin shoot bolts into pre formed metal cleats operated by a single lockable handle.
Laminated or toughened glazing dependent on Client requirement, is an option.

Electrical Installation

General

Cables, luminaries, heating appliances, protective devices and all other fittings and materials used in the installation are manufactured to the relevant British Standards.  All cables used are BASEC approved.

The Distribution board will located in the plant room, and incorporate an RCD with an earth leakage sensitivity of 30 mA. Final circuits are protected with appropriate rated MCBS. The switchgear is manufactured by Proteus or equivalent and enclosed in suitable enclosure.
All work carried out is by approved craftsmen and complies with the16th Edition of the IEE Regulations.

Lighting

Internal Lighting            

Fluorescent luminaries 1500 mm long complete with prismatic controller The luminaries are gang controlled from a single gang switch to BS 3676 as MK or equivalent mounted adjacent to the door.
Moisture resistant light fittings to shower areas.

External Lighting

The bulkhead luminaries are Phillips FGC 1 00/1 1 1 or equivalent and are individually controlled from the single gang switch to BS 3676 and as manufactured by MK or equivalent.

Power Points

Twin 13 amp switched socket outlets to BS 1363 as manufactured by MK or equivalent. Quantity of outlets per unit as listed on pricing schedule.
Dado trunking and / or Data points fitted to clients specifications.

Bonding and Earthing

All pipes, metalwork (including fixtures and fittings) are electrically bonded to each other by a continuous conductor and the bonding conductor is taken to the main earthing terminal in the consumer unit. The chassis and superstructure steel framing ( if applicable ) is similarly bonded, to the mass of steel cladding.

All metal surfaces, are to be permanently earthed as previously described.


Tests

On completion of the work the contractor will carry out tests in accordance with the IEE 16th Edition Test certificates shall be completed in duplicate and submitted to the client.

Plumbing Specification.

General

The plumbing installations comply with all Building and Water Authority Regulations.

Wash Hand Basin (460 x 305)

Twyfords 'Classic' or equivalent white vitreous china, (size 460 x 305 mm) complete with overflow and a pair of stainless steel supporting legs to each basin.  The basins to have plugs and chrome plated non-concessive taps.

                     

Toilets

Twyfords 'Classic' or equivalent white vitreous china washdown WC pan with horizontal outlet to BS 5503, complete with a 9 litre white vitreous china cistern and cover to BS 1125 : 1987 with all fittings suitable for mains pressure.  The cistern incorporates a cover clip, along with a chrome plated lever handle and 19 mm overflow warning pipe which is terminate through the external walling.  A black plastic seat and cover is provided for each WC.

Urinals

Twyfords 'Clifton' or equivalent, white vitreous china bowl urinal complete with chrome plated strainer. Suitably sized white vitreous chain cistern to BS 1876 : including syphon and drip tap is provided.  Stainless steel flush pipe with spreader and clip is fitted between the cistern and the bowl.  Each set of urinals is fitted with a flushing control device such as a cisternmiser or equivalent.

Sink Unit

Consisting of a sink base unit, faced in white melamine with lipped edges to match and fitted with heavy duty plastic handles. 90 mm white melamine faced plinths are included.  Units are 1000 x 600 as Solas range and are complete with single drainer, stainless steel top, (LH or RH), 2 pillar taps and associated waste assembly.

Waste Pipes
All waste pipes from the sanitary fittings is UPVC to BS 4514 and of an appropriate size to suit the fittings.  The urinals and wash basins have75 mm deep traps and the showers have a 50 mm deep trap. The waste pipe work is located above floor level and terminate into an air admittance valve/drain connection. Head of drain runs vented to atmosphere.

Tests
On completion of the plumbing installation, the necessary tests are carried out to ensure that all joints are complete and leak free.
